Princess to make Islam school visit

Her Royal Highness Princess Maha Chakri Sirindhorn will visit Prateepsasana Islamic School in Nakhon Si Thammarat next week.

Surin Pitsuwan, chairman of the school's Foundation for Educational Development, said the princess would pay a private visit next Monday.

Mr Surin, a former secretary-general of Asean, said the princess has shown interest in the teaching and management methods of Prateepsasana, regarded as one of the country's leading private Islamic schools.

During one of the princess's visits to Narathiwat province, she made it known to her close aides that she wanted other schools in the South to be run in a similar manner to Prateepsasana.

The princess is the patron of 14 Islamic schools in the South.
